My new favorite ice cream trick!!

Get some ripe bananas (with brown spots on the skin), cut into pieces and freeze for several hours.

Once frozen, blend or process bananas with a little milk, soy milk or almond milk until perfectly smooth and the consistency of a thick milkshake. Enjoy!! (I add PB2 or Just Great Stuff powdered chocolate peanut butter)

(you can also freeze the blended banana to make it firmer or into popsicles)

super creamy, same mouth feel as ice cream and no added sugar!

Ice cream was one of my downfalls of the past. Now I take chunky frozen fruits, about a cup, (my fav is a mango, pineapple, strawberry and papaya mix from Costco) and mix with a scoop of vanilla Protein powder. I use a stick/immersion blender and spin it up using no or as little added liquid as possible. I have to chop the bigger pieces of fruit with a knife beforehand. It comes out like a rich frozen yogurt. These are some of the higher sugar fruits so I only use this as an occasional treat, but boy is it good! Leftovers get too solid in the freezer for me so I share my batch.
